Home Appliances Rental Market Summary

The Global Home Appliances Rental Market Size was estimated at USD 44.63 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 121.72 billion by 2035, growing at a CAGR of 9.55% from 2025 to 2035. The factors stimulating the expansion of the home appliance rental market are the demand for flexibility, affordability, especially among urban residents and millennials, the demand for high levels of mobility, short-term accommodations, and the rise of subscription-type business models.

 

Key Market Trends & Insights

  • In 2024, Asia Pacific held a revenue share of 34.63%, resulting in dominance of the market.
  • The rental market in India is Expanding, and Demand is Growing in both tier-1 and tier-2 cities.
  • A market share of 33.67% was held by the washers and dryers category by appliance type in the global home appliances rental market.
  • The offline distribution channel led the global home appliance rental market in 2024, with a dominant 79.59% market share.

 

Market Size & Forecast

  • 2024 Market Size: USD 44.63 Billion
  • 2035 Projected Market Size: USD 121.72 Billion
  • CAGR (2025-2035): 9.55%
  • Asia Pacific: Largest market in 2024
  • Central & South America: Fastest growing market in the forecasted period.

 

Global Home Appliances Rental Market

 

The market in which companies rent home appliances like air conditioners, refrigerators, and washing machines instead of selling these appliances to consumers or businesses is called the home appliances rental market. Typically, these rental operations are run by rental companies that maintain a stock of appliances and charge customers for renting the appliances.  As more customers seek flexible and affordable ways to solve home appliance needs, the market for renting home appliances is growing.  The desire to avoid a high upfront cost, maintenance obligations, and ownership commitment is the reason behind the desire to rent appliances. This trend is especially prevalent in urban areas, where renting makes sense due to smaller living spaces and transient lifestyles.

 

The market for renting home appliances is set to expand further as consumer demand for flexibility, technology advances, and a general trend toward sustainable consumption is rising. Organizations that adapt to these trends and focus on customer-focused solutions are likely to thrive as the market evolves. The market is full of opportunity. Demand for home appliance rentals is expected to explode in developing economies as income and urbanization increase. The growth of e-commerce and digital platforms has made rentals easier for consumers. Organizations can also target niche markets by renting out high-end appliances or offering value-added services, such as maintenance and installation.

 

Market development is also influenced by government investments and policies. Supportive policies may prompt businesses to offer sustainable products and rental services. Consumer protection laws may ensure that rental appliances are safe and provided to standards. These aspects enrich the market structure and provide a consistent, growing environment. Renting an appliance is more accessible than ever through the advent of digital platforms. Digital-first rental providers have developed a streamlined experience allowing customers to search, select, and schedule delivery incrementally. Digital transformation appeals to a tech-savvy consumer segment and stimulates growth in the market.

 

The rental appliance market is evolving with the introduction of smart technology. Appliances that have Internet of Things (IoT) capabilities increase the user experience and can improve operational efficiencies by enabling remote use and monitoring of appliances. These solutions allow rental companies to improve predictive maintenance and reduce downtime, which can add value for customers. Businesses and consumers alike are implementing more sustainable actions as a result of environmental concerns, and renting appliances supports the reuse of products and longer lifespans, which supports the principles of the circular economy. When customers rent, they can also help reduce electronic waste and conserve resources.

 

Appliance Type Insights

 

In 2024, the washers and dryers category by appliance type held a 33.67% market share in the global rental market for household appliances. This category is a favored area for rental services due to the amount of use and necessity that exists within a home. The usefulness and the increased sponsored preference for renting rather than owning when usage is limited are the key contributors to the increasing demand. The increasing cost of housing, or frustration with rental units, new urban flow, and the growth in shared and short-term housing are other contributing factors to its dominance in the product landscape. Renting washing machines or dryers results in customers having access to the appliances that they need without the pressures of ownership or maintenance. These appliances are very practical for everyday conveniences, specifically for professionals, students, or city dwellers.

The air conditioner category is expected to account for a CAGR of 12.34% from 2025 to 2035. The main factors driving this growth include rising global temperatures, growing demand for indoor comfort, as well as increasing awareness of air quality. Due to seasonal usage, increasing rental air conditioners are due for an increase in both households and businesses.  Given the high upfront cost of ownership and demand for even more energy-efficient models, rental air conditioners are becoming attractive.  Emerging economies in the Middle East and Asia-Pacific are demonstrating the strongest level of demand (affordability) for rental solutions as consumers search for budget-friendly cooling.  Long-term market growth is supported by flexible leasing options, allowing inverter-based and smart-connected air conditioning units to come on the market.

 

Distribution Channel Insights

Global Home Appliances Rental Market

 

The offline distribution channel category by distribution channel accounted for a market share of 79.59% in the global home appliances rental market in 2024. The ongoing dominance of physical rental showrooms and physical inspection of appliances beforehand, which results in substantial trust gained through personalized services and immediate customer support, especially in developing economies, all contribute to this dominance even further. Offline channels benefit from being able to provide direct customer service assistance and have established shipping channels for larger products, such as air conditioners, washing machines, and refrigerators.

 

The online distribution channel is forecasted to grow at a CAGR of 11.25% from 2025 to 2035. Some of the main factors causing this upsurge are increased use of e-commerce, greater digital penetration, and changing consumer preferences towards contactless purchases and flexible rental arrangements.  Although online rental services should see greater popularity as consumers adapt to doing business remotely due to rising internet penetration, consumers are also turning to online platforms due to their convenience, flexible rental schedules, and home delivery options.  Overall, a dramatic uptick in online channel usage will correlate with the emerging trend of urban consumers, including tech-savvy millennials and Gen Z in developing cities, using online platforms looking for convenience, a greater selection of rental products, and ease of comparing rental products.

 

Regional Insights

Asia Pacific Home Appliances Rental Market Trends

The renting of household appliances across Asia Pacific accounted for 34.63% of the overall market in 2024. The sector's dominant position is due in large part to rapid urbanization, more middle-class people, and an increasingly strong demand for flexible and affordable living solutions. Renting household appliances to avoid the purchase completely has gained in popularity due to high turnover in real estate, the movement of students and professionals in and around urban areas. The growth of the area has been characterized by strong consumer acceptance as evidenced in the market share based on high population density in many of countries. Major contributors to the growth area are China, Japan, and India.

 

  • India is emerging with a strong interest in renting, particularly around tier-1 and tier-2 cities, where students and young professionals prefer affordable, short-term access to appliances. Penetration within the rental segment has been aided by the rise of subscription platforms and app-based rental companies.

 

  • China has an enormous population in urban rental locations, a strong digital infrastructure, and is set up for seamless appliance rentals in ecosystems with integrated e-commerce.

 

  • Japan's demand for rental services certainly is a product of the small footprint of living space, high costs of appliances, and market share among temporary workers and single-person residences.

 

Central & South America Home Appliances Rental Market Trends

Central and South America are expected to achieve the fastest growth rate with 10.9% in the global home appliance rental market due to a combination of increasing middle-class population, urbanization, and demand for flexible and affordable living.  In particular, countries such as Brazil, Colombia, and Mexico, where young professionals and renters desire simple, low-commitment access to essential home appliances, there is a constant increase in residential development and modern living, more so than ever before. Furthermore, even in the far corners of the Earth, thanks to the rapid emergence of digital rental platforms and mobile-based payment systems, consumers can now access short and long-term rental services easily.

 

North America Home Appliances Rental Market Trends

In 2024, North America had a 27.52% rental market share for household appliances worldwide.  The rental market in this region is being fueled by high rates of urbanization, increasing housing mobility, and growing acceptance of rental living in metropolitan areas in the U.S. and Canada.  Appliance rentals, which offer convenience, fast delivery, and maintenance service, are being demanded because consumers, especially millennials and Gen Z, are forgoing ownership to pursue flexible, economical alternatives to ownership. The region has also seen increases in an influx of furnished rentals, temporary relocations, and long-term corporate housing needs, which have helped fuel ongoing interest in rental equipment. North America is expected to remain an important market for appliance rental services in the years ahead, especially due to its better infrastructure, established digital payments, and changing consumer preferences.

  • In December 2024, Samsung Electronics has officially entered the home appliance subscription service, initiating a direct competition against LG Electronics, the reigning leader of the market. Samsung will launch its "AI Subscription Club" from its website, Samsung.com, and Samsung stores across the country. The program reduces the upfront purchase cost and makes premium appliances more affordable as it allows users to pay a monthly fee to rent home appliances for a fixed term. Over 90% of the eligible products will have artificial intelligence (AI) features, including televisions, refrigerators, washers, and vacuum cleaners
